Transaction 4b35c23d124b95d593626fe51657a2e9812bd5acee40992cf9705aea80dd072a

1 Input
2 Outputs
  • 4b35c23d124b95d593626fe51657a2e9812bd5acee40992cf9705aea80dd072a:0
  • value  1922811
    address  38oK9KCgCJrGuKFNL5WYBQBNz1QqwesotR
  • 4b35c23d124b95d593626fe51657a2e9812bd5acee40992cf9705aea80dd072a:1
  • value  33630
    address  1GdEKYDFSmzhWJQKvueRGKM83jkPxsS7yn